Is this covered under warranty?

Two of my OEM wheels have the paint finish peeling off of them. Is this the type of thing that would be covered under warranty?

I'm reluctant to ask the dealer as the car is leased and if this isn't warrantable, I don't want them making a note of this for when the car is turned back in.

Seriously doubt it's covered. At the end of the day, on lease returns, as long as the car is in nearly the same condition as you bought it (no scratches or dents larger than a dime, plenty of tread on the rubber, etc), then they're not going to ding you. This means if you're near your lease termination date, you can spend a few bucks to bring the car back to better shape (refinish the wheels, etc) and you'll be better off $$$-wise than letting BMW ding you.
